RESUMEN

BACKGROUND: The choice of bronchodilators for responsiveness testing (BRT) is a clinical decision according to ATS/ERS. Since January 2019 we use budesonide/formoterol for BRT in asthma at our center in Argentina. The aim was to compare budesonide/formoterol with salbutamol for BRT in stable asthmatic patients that were followed up in a short-acting beta2 agonist (SABA)-free asthma center. METHODS: From the Hospital database, we found for the same patient at least one BRT using salbutamol 200 µg and another with budesonide/formoterol 320/9 µg. RESULTS: We found similar BRT between salbutamol and budesonide/formoterol in 101 asthmatic individuals (26 males) aged 38.14 ± 16.1 yrs (mean ± Standard deviation). The absolute response was 0.18 ± 0.21 L in FEV1 after salbutamol and 0.20 ± 0.22 L in FEV1 after budesonide/formoterol. Afterwards, we showed 202 patients tested with budesonide/formoterol; the mean absolute response was 0.21 ± 0.22 L in FEV1. There were no unexpected safety findings. CONCLUSIONS: In asthmatic patients, we demonstrated similar efficacy between Budesonide/formoterol and salbutamol for BRT.

RESUMEN

BACKGROUND: Circadian rhythms are important for all aspects of biology; virtually every aspect of biological function varies according to time of day. Although this is well known, variation across the day is also often ignored in the design and reporting of research. For this review, we analyzed the top 50 cited papers across 10 major domains of the biological sciences in the calendar year 2015. We repeated this analysis for the year 2019, hypothesizing that the awarding of a Nobel Prize in 2017 for achievements in the field of circadian biology would highlight the importance of circadian rhythms for scientists across many disciplines, and improve time-of-day reporting. RESULTS: Our analyses of these 1000 empirical papers, however, revealed that most failed to include sufficient temporal details when describing experimental methods and that few systematic differences in time-of-day reporting existed between 2015 and 2019. Overall, only 6.1% of reports included time-of-day information about experimental measures and manipulations sufficient to permit replication. CONCLUSIONS: Circadian rhythms are a defining feature of biological systems, and knowing when in the circadian day these systems are evaluated is fundamentally important information. Failing to account for time of day hampers reproducibility across laboratories, complicates interpretation of results, and reduces the value of data based predominantly on nocturnal animals when extrapolating to diurnal humans.

RESUMEN

Availability of artificial light and light-emitting devices have altered human temporal life, allowing 24-hour healthcare, commerce and production, and expanding social life around the clock. However, physiology and behavior that evolved in the context of 24 h solar days are frequently perturbed by exposure to artificial light at night. This is particularly salient in the context of circadian rhythms, the result of endogenous biological clocks with a rhythm of ~24 h. Circadian rhythms govern the temporal features of physiology and behavior, and are set to precisely 24 h primarily by exposure to light during the solar day, though other factors, such as the timing of meals, can also affect circadian rhythms. Circadian rhythms are significantly affected by night shift work because of exposure to nocturnal light, electronic devices, and shifts in the timing of meals. Night shift workers are at increased risk for metabolic disorder, as well as several types of cancer. Others who are exposed to artificial light at night or late mealtimes also show disrupted circadian rhythms and increased metabolic and cardiac disorders. It is imperative to understand how disrupted circadian rhythms alter metabolic function to develop strategies to mitigate their negative effects. In this review, we provide an introduction to circadian rhythms, physiological regulation of homeostasis by the suprachiasmatic nucleus (SCN), and SCN-mediated hormones that display circadian rhythms, including melatonin and glucocorticoids. Next, we discuss circadian-gated physiological processes including sleep and food intake, followed by types of disrupted circadian rhythms and how modern lighting disrupts molecular clock rhythms. Lastly, we identify how disruptions to hormones and metabolism can increase susceptibility to metabolic syndrome and risk for cardiovascular diseases, and discuss various strategies to mitigate the harmful consequences associated with disrupted circadian rhythms on human health.

RESUMEN

Changes to photoperiod (day length) occur in anticipation of seasonal environmental changes, altering physiology and behavior to maximize fitness. In order for photoperiod to be useful as a predictive factor of temperature or food availability, day and night must be distinct. The increasing prevalence of exposure to artificial light at night (ALAN) in both field and laboratory settings disrupts photoperiodic time measurement and may block development of appropriate seasonal adaptations. Here, we review the effects of ALAN as a disruptor of photoperiodic time measurement and season-specific adaptations, including reproduction, metabolism, immune function, and thermoregulation.

RESUMEN

BACKGROUND: Acute respiratory failure (ARF) has become one of the most prevalent serious pathologies encountered in the emergency medical service (EMS). In hospital settings, noninvasive ventilation (NIV) therapy prevents complications from more aggressive treatments for that condition. However, the scarce evidence on the benefits of NIV in prehospital EMS (i.e., during transport to the hospital) is inconclusive. OBJECTIVES: To determine whether the administration of NIV during prehospital EMS in cases of ARF reduces in-hospital mortality compared with starting NIV on arrival to in-patient EMS. METHODS: This is a multicentre, observational, prospective cohort study. We recruited a total of 317 patients from the Madrid region (Spain) who were prescribed NIV for their ARF using a nonprobabilistic consecutive sampling method. Analyses of the main outcome (in-hospital mortality) and secondary outcomes (length of hospital stay, readmissions, percentage of intensive care unit admissions, and cost-effectiveness) will include descriptive analyses of patients' characteristics, as well as bivariate and multivariate analyses and cost-effectiveness analysis. DISCUSSION: This study will provide data on NIV management in prehospital and in-patient EMS in patients with ARF. Results will contribute to the existing evidence on the benefits of NIV in the context of prehospital EMS while underlining the importance of a standardized formal training for physicians and nurses working in prehospital and in-patient EMSs. CONCLUSION: The VentilaMadrid study will provide valuable data on the clinical factors of patients receiving NIV in prehospital EMS. Further, were our hypothesis to be confirmed, our results would strongly suggest that the administration of NIV in prehospital EMS by medical and nursing profesionals formally trained in the technique reduces mortality and improves prognoses.

RESUMEN

The advent and wide-spread adoption of electric lighting over the past century has profoundly affected the circadian organization of physiology and behavior for many individuals in industrialized nations; electric lighting in homes, work environments, and public areas have extended daytime activities into the evening, thus, increasing night-time exposure to light. Although initially assumed to be innocuous, chronic exposure to light at night (LAN) is now associated with increased incidence of cancer, metabolic disorders, and affective problems in humans. However, little is known about potential acute effects of LAN. To determine whether acute exposure to low-level LAN alters brain function, adult male, and female mice were housed in either light days and dark nights (LD; 14 h of 150 lux:10 h of 0 lux) or light days and low level light at night (LAN; 14 h of 150 lux:10 h of 5 lux). Mice exposed to LAN on three consecutive nights increased depressive-like responses compared to mice housed in dark nights. In addition, female mice exposed to LAN increased central tendency in the open field. LAN was associated with reduced hippocampal vascular endothelial growth factor-A (VEGF-A) in both male and female mice, as well as increased VEGFR1 and interleukin-1ß mRNA expression in females, and reduced brain derived neurotrophic factor mRNA in males. Further, LAN significantly altered circadian rhythms (activity and temperature) and circadian gene expression in female and male mice, respectively. Altogether, this study demonstrates that acute exposure to LAN alters brain physiology and can be detrimental to well-being in otherwise healthy individuals.

RESUMEN

Alkaptonuria is a rare autosomal-recessive disorder that produces accumulation of homogentisic acid in body fluids. The accumulation in collagen tissues, mainly in the joint cartilage, produces ochronotic arthropathy. We report two clinical cases of one brother and sister with alkaptonuria and ochronotic arthropathy diagnosed in old age. In the first case, the patient is diagnosed by musculoskeletal involvement with long-term low back pain with other associated manifestations that made this pathology suspected. In the second case, the patient comes due to osteoporosis and other associated fractures and with the family history and the rest of the clinic, the appropriate complementary tests were performed and the diagnosis is established. It is unknown if there is consanguinity in these patients between parents or ancestors. It is an infrequent pathology that is often diagnosed intraoperatively. Despite the poor efficacy of medical treatment, it would be advisable to make an early diagnosis to avoid accumulation of the pigment and accelerated joint destruction and deposition in other locations. Owing to its prevalence, it is difficult to find a significant number of patients to search for new treatments that are intended to correct the enzyme deficit and not only to modify the elimination.

RESUMEN

BACKGROUND: Radiofrequency ablation (RFA) of high-grade squamous intraepithelial lesions (HSIL) is a promising minimally invasive technique but its oncologic and functional outcomes are not well studied. The primary outcome was the efficacy of RFA, and the secondary outcomes were the functional and anatomical anal changes related to RFA. METHODS: This was a retrospective analysis of our prospectively collected database of patients who had RFA for HSIL at our institution, between August 2018 and March 2020. To be eligible for RFA, all patients had impairment of their immune function. Targeted ablation was applied in all cases, with 5 overlapping pulsations at the targeted HSILs (delivering 12 J/cm2 per application) followed by circumferential, 2-pulsation (12 J/cm2) overlapping anal ablation, to cover the entire anal transition zone. Patients were assessed for recurrence or metachronous disease at 3-month intervals by means of high-resolution anoscopy (HRA) and targeted biopsies. Anorectal manometry, endoanal ultrasound, the 36-Item Short Form and Massachusetts General Hospital-Sexual Functioning Questionnaire (MGH-SFQ) were assessed at baseline and 12 months after intervention. RESULTS: We included a total of 12 patients with anal HSILs. The mean age was 38.6 (± 7.68) years, and 7 (58.3%) were males. Six were HIV positive, 2 had a primary immunodeficiency disease, and 4 were receiving immunosuppressive therapy. A mean of 2.1 anal HSILs per patient were treated. At 12 months, high-resolution anoscopy showed that 7/12 (58.3%) patients had normal high-resolution anoscopy, 3/12 patients had recurrent HSILs, and 2/12 had a persistent lesion. Those lesions were treated with electrocautery, and reached complete response in the following the 6 months (total of 18 months). In particular, there were no metachronous lesions detected. Patients reported moderate to severe pain during the first 24 h after RFA, but only mild discomfort was present at 30 days. Patients were asymptomatic at their 6- and 12-month visits. RFA was not associated with changes in anorectal manometry or ultrasound examination. The 36-SF survey reported improvement in the general health domain (p = 0.038), while the MGH-SFQ showed improvements in sexual function. CONCLUSIONS: In this study, targeted plus circumferential RFA had a 58.3% efficacy rate for the treatment of anal HSIL in immunocompromised patients, achieving 100% eradication after adding electrocautery ablation. No metachronous lesions were detected. Patients presented relatively mild symptoms after the procedure, no changes in anorectal anatomy or function, and some improvements in their sexual function. These results seem promising in light of the high recurrence reported after HSIL treatment. Larger studies are needed to validate our results.

RESUMEN

Circadian rhythms are endogenous biological cycles that synchronize physiology and behaviour to promote optimal function. These ~24-hr internal rhythms are set to precisely 24 hr daily by exposure to the sun. However, the prevalence of night-time lighting has the potential to dysregulate these biological functions. Hospital patients may be particularly vulnerable to the consequences of light at night because of their compromised physiological state. A mouse model of stroke (middle cerebral artery occlusion; MCAO) was used to test the hypothesis that exposure to dim light at night impairs responses to a major insult. Stroke lesion size was substantially larger among animals housed in dLAN after reperfusion than animals maintained in dark nights. Mice housed in dLAN for three days after the stroke displayed increased post-stroke anxiety-like behaviour. Overall, dLAN amplified pro-inflammatory pathways in the CNS, which may have exacerbated neuronal damage. Our results suggest that exposure to LAN is detrimental to stroke recovery.

RESUMEN

Breast cancer survivors receiving chemotherapy often report increased anxiety and depression. However, the mechanism underlying chemotherapy-induced changes in affect remains unknown. We hypothesized that chemotherapy increases cytokine production, in turn altering exploratory and depressive-like behavior. To test this hypothesis, female Balb/C mice received two injections, separated by two weeks, of vehicle (0.9% saline) or a chemotherapeutic cocktail [9 mg/kg doxorubicin (A) and 90 mg/kg cyclophosphamide (C)]. Peripheral and central cytokine concentrations were increased one and seven days, respectively, after AC. Because of the beneficial effects of social enrichment on several diseases with inflammatory components, we examined whether social enrichment could attenuate the increase in peripheral and central cytokine production following chemotherapy administration. Socially isolated mice receiving AC therapy demonstrated increased depressive-like and exploratory behaviors with a concurrent increase in hippocampal IL-6. Whereas, group housing attenuated AC-induced IL-6 and depressive-like behavior. Next, we sought to determine whether central oxytocin may contribute to the protective effects of social housing after AC administration. Intracerebroventricular administration of oxytocin to socially isolated mice recapitulated the protective effects of social enrichment; specifically, oxytocin ameliorated the AC-induced effects on IL-6 and depressive-like behavior. Furthermore, administration of an oxytocin antagonist to group housed mice recapitulated the responses of socially isolated mice; specifically, AC increased depressive-like behavior and central IL-6. These data suggest a possible neuroprotective role for oxytocin following chemotherapy, via modulation of IL-6. This study adds to the growing literature detailing the negative behavioral effects of chemotherapy and provides further evidence that social enrichment may be beneficial to health.

RESUMEN

Crystalglobulinemia is an extremely rare pathology that is associated in most cases with plasma cell dyscrasia, mainly multiple myeloma. In most cases, it may be the manifestation of incipient gammopathy or it manifests shortly after diagnosis. We report a patient with ischemic lesions of thrombotic origin in lower limbs. Subsequently, renal involvement occurs, in view of this involvement, it is suspected that the patient may have an associated vasculitis. After performing the biopsy and with the subsequent diagnosis of monoclonal gammopathy of uncertain significance, the diagnosis is made. We review the most recent bibliography of patients who have been diagnosed with crystalglobulinemia associated with plasma dyscrasia focusing in those with thrombotic vasculopathy or acute renal failure. In our case, in addition to being associated with monoclonal gammopathy of undetermined significance that is less frequent, the debut of the symptoms is years before the detection of the monoclonal peak. This could speak of patients with a low peak of monoclonal component (not detected by immunoelectrophoresis) who could have kidney and vascular damage.

RESUMEN

For many individuals in industrialized nations, the widespread adoption of electric lighting has dramatically affected the circadian organization of physiology and behavior. Although initially assumed to be innocuous, exposure to artificial light at night (ALAN) is associated with several disorders, including increased incidence of cancer, metabolic disorders, and mood disorders. Within this review, we present a brief overview of the molecular circadian clock system and the importance of maintaining fidelity to bright days and dark nights. We describe the interrelation between core clock genes and the cell cycle, as well as the contribution of clock genes to oncogenesis. Next, we review the clinical implications of disrupted circadian rhythms on cancer, followed by a section on the foundational science literature on the effects of light at night and cancer. Finally, we provide some strategies for mitigation of disrupted circadian rhythms to improve health.

RESUMEN

MAIN CONCLUSION: Heat and water stresses, individually or combined, affect both the plant (development, physiology, and production) and the pathogens (growth, morphology, dissemination, distribution, and virulence). The grapevine response to combined abiotic and biotic stresses is complex and cannot be inferred from the response to each single stress. Several factors might impact the response and the recovery of the grapevine, such as the intensity, duration, and timing of the stresses. In the heat/water stress-GTDs-grapevine interaction, the nature of the pathogens, and the host, i.e., the nature of the rootstock, the cultivar and the clone, has a great importance. This review highlights the lack of studies investigating the response to combined stresses, in particular molecular studies, and the misreading of the relationship between rootstock and scion in the relationship GTDs/abiotic stresses. Grapevine trunk diseases (GTDs) are one of the biggest threats to vineyard sustainability in the next 30 years. Although many treatments and practices are used to manage GTDs, there has been an increase in the prevalence of these diseases due to several factors such as vineyard intensification, aging vineyards, or nursery practices. The ban of efficient treatments, i.e., sodium arsenite, carbendazim, and benomyl, in the early 2000s may be partly responsible for the fast spread of these diseases. However, GTD-associated fungi can act as endophytes for several years on, or inside the vine until the appearance of the first symptoms. This prompted several researchers to hypothesise that abiotic conditions, especially thermal and water stresses, were involved in the initiation of GTD symptoms. Unfortunately, the frequency of these abiotic conditions occurring is likely to increase according to the recent consensus scenario of climate change, especially in wine-growing areas. In this article, following a review on the impact of combined thermal and water stresses on grapevine physiology, we will examine (1) how this combination of stresses might influence the lifestyle of GTD pathogens, (2) learnings from grapevine field experiments and modelling aiming at studying biotic and abiotic stresses, and (3) what mechanistic concepts can be used to explain how these stresses might affect the grapevine plant status.

RESUMEN

BACKGROUND AND PURPOSE: The European Charcot Foundation supported the development of a set of surveys to understand current practice patterns for the diagnosis and management of multiple sclerosis (MS) in Europe. Part 2 of the report summarizes survey results related to secondary progressive MS (SPMS), primary progressive MS (PPMS), pregnancy, paediatric MS and overall patient management. METHODS: A steering committee of MS neurologists developed case- and practice-based questions for two sequential surveys distributed to MS neurologists throughout Europe. RESULTS: Respondents generally favoured changing rather than stopping disease-modifying treatment (DMT) in patients transitioning from relapsing-remitting MS to SPMS, particularly with active disease. Respondents would not initiate DMT in patients with typical PPMS symptoms, although the presence of ≥1 spinal cord or brain gadolinium-enhancing lesion might affect that decision. For patients considering pregnancy, respondents were equally divided on whether to stop treatment before or after conception. Respondents strongly favoured starting DMT in paediatric MS with active disease; recommended treatments included interferon, glatiramer acetate and, in John Cunningham virus negative patients, natalizumab. Additional results regarding practice-based questions and management are summarized. CONCLUSIONS: Results of part 2 of the survey of diagnostic and treatment practices for MS in Europe largely mirror results for part 1, with neurologists in general agreement about the treatment and management of SPMS, PPMS, pregnancy and paediatric MS as well as the general management of MS. However, there are also many areas of disagreement, indicating the need for evidence-based recommendations and/or guidelines.

RESUMEN

BACKGROUND AND PURPOSE: Up-to-date information is needed on the extent to which neurologists treating multiple sclerosis (MS) in Europe are integrating rapidly evolving diagnostic criteria, disease-modifying therapies and recommendations for monitoring disease activity into their clinical practice. METHODS: A steering committee of MS neurologists used a modified Delphi process to develop case- and practice-based questions for two sequential surveys distributed to MS neurologists throughout Europe. Case-based questions were developed for radiologically isolated syndrome (RIS), clinically isolated syndrome (CIS), relapsing-remitting MS (RRMS) and RRMS with breakthrough disease. RESULTS: Multiple sclerosis neurologists from 11 European countries responded to survey 1 (n = 233) and survey 2 (n = 171). Respondents agreed that they would not treat the patients in the RIS or CIS cases but would treat a patient with a relatively mild form of RRMS. Choice of treatment was evenly distributed among first-line injectables and oral treatments for mild RRMS, and moved to second-line treatment as the RRMS case increased in severity. Additional results on RRMS with breakthrough disease are presented. CONCLUSIONS: Although there was general agreement on some aspects of treatment, responses to other management and clinical practice questions varied considerably. These results, which reflect current clinical practice patterns, highlight the need for additional MS treatment education and awareness and may help inform the development of MS practice guidelines in Europe.

RESUMEN

Mancozeb is a dithiocarbamate non-systemic agricultural fungicide with multi-site, protective action. It helps to control many fungal diseases in a wide range of field crops, fruits, nuts, vegetables, and ornamental plants. We have investigated the stability profiles of mancozeb in aqueous solutions to determine the effect of pH, temperature and light on the degradation process of mancozeb. In addition, the toxicological risk for humans associated with the joint intake of mancoze7b and its final degradation product, ethylenethiourea (ETU), was calculated and modelled as a function of the experimental conditions. Stability study results showed a very low stability profile of mancozeb in all the aqueous solutions with rapid degradation that varied with experimental conditions. The process followed first order kinetics. The study of the degradation kinetics showed a significant effect of pH*temperature interaction on the degradation process. The results also expressed that light has a greater impact on the stability of mancozeb and the formation of ETU. The current study concludes that mancozeb is unstable in aqueous solutions, particularly at an acid pH, in addition to presenting both severe light and lower temperature sensitivity. The toxicological risk associated with mancozeb degradation increases with time and temperature, being higher at basic pH and in absence of light.

RESUMEN

With the advent of new disease-modifying drugs, the treatment of multiple sclerosis is becoming increasingly complex. Using consensus statements is therefore advisable. The present consensus statement, which was drawn up by the Spanish Society of Neurology's study group for demyelinating diseases, updates previous consensus statements on the disease. The present study lists the medications currently approved for multiple sclerosis and their official indications, and analyses such treatment-related aspects as activity, early treatment, maintenance, follow-up, treatment failure, changes in medication, and special therapeutic situations. This consensus statement includes treatment recommendations for a wide range of demyelinating diseases, from isolated demyelinating syndromes to the different forms of multiple sclerosis, as well as recommendations for initial therapy and changes in drug medication, and additional comments on induction and combined therapy and practical aspects of the use of these drugs.

RESUMEN

BACKGROUND AIMS: Immunomodulatory properties of human umbilical cord-derived mesenchymal stromal cells (UCMSCs) can be differentially modulated by toll-like receptors (TLR) agonists. Here, the therapeutic efficacy of short TLR3 and TLR4 pre-conditioning of UCMSCs was evaluated in a dextran sulfate sodium (DSS)-induced colitis in mice. The novelty of this study is that although modulation of human MSCs activity by TLRs is not a new concept, this is the first time that short TLR pre-conditioning has been carried out in a murine inflammatory model of acute colitis. METHODS: C57BL/6 mice were exposed to 2.5% dextran sulfate sodium (DSS) in drinking water ad libitum for 7 days. At days 1 and 3, mice were injected intraperitoneally with 1 × 10(6) UCMSCs untreated or TLR3 and TLR4 pre-conditioned UCMSCs. UCMSCs were pre-conditioned with poly(I:C) for TLR3 and LPS for TLR4 for 1 h at 37°C and 5% CO2. We evaluated clinical signs of disease and body weights daily. At the end of the experiment, colon length and histological changes were assessed. RESULTS: poly(I:C) pre-conditioned UCMSCs significantly ameliorated the clinical and histopathological severity of DSS-induced colitis compared with UCMSCs or LPS pre-conditioned UCMSCs. In contrast, infusion of LPS pre-conditioned UCMSCs significantly increased clinical signs of disease, colon shortening and histological disease index in DSS-induced colitis. CONCLUSIONS: These results show that short in vitro TLR3 pre-conditioning with poly(I:C) enhances the therapeutic efficacy of UCMSCs, which is a major breakthrough for developing improved treatments to patients with inflammatory bowel disease.

RESUMEN

UNLABELLED: The purpose of this study was to adapt the 'Voice and You' Scale (VAY) (Hayward, Denney, Vaughan, & Fowler, 2008) to Spanish and explore its psychometric properties for measuring the perceived relationship with voices. A sample of 50 psychiatric patients with verbal auditory hallucinations (48 had a psychotic disorder and two a borderline personality disorder) was used. Its reliability was calculated using the Cronbach's α and test-retest, and concurrent validity by the Pearson correlation coefficient of the VAY with the Beliefs About Voices Questionnaire and the Psychotic Symptom Rating Scales. The results showed that internal consistency of the Spanish version of the VAY ranged from 0.74 to 0.84 on the various subscales, and test-retest reliability varied from 0.74 to 0.83 on three subscales (voice 'dominance', 'intrusiveness' and hearer 'dependence'), and was lower (0.68) on the hearer 'distance' subscale. Concurrent validity was acceptable as significant associations were found with the Beliefs About Voices Questionnaire and the Psychotic Symptom Rating Scales subscales. It is concluded that the Spanish version of the VAY is a reliable and valid instrument that can assist the exploration of voices within relational frameworks across research and clinical domains. KEY PRACTITIONER MESSAGE: The Spanish version of the VAY is a reliable, valid instrument for evaluating the perception a person can have about his or her relationship with the voices and how the person relates to them. Voices that are perceived as relating dominantly and intrusively, and from whom distance is sought, seem to be distressing and cause disturbance. Voices that are related to dependently are perceived as having benevolent intent and are engaged with. Benevolent or neutral voices may be considered as intrusive because of the intensity and frequency with which they are experienced.

RESUMEN

INTRODUCTION: Natalizumab treatment has been shown to be very efficacious in clinical trials and very effective in clinical practice in patients with relapsing-remitting multiple sclerosis, by reducing relapses, slowing disease progression, and improving magnetic resonance imaging patterns. However, the drug has also been associated with a risk of progressive multifocal leukoencephalopathy (PML). The first consensus statement on natalizumab use, published in 2011, has been updated to include new data on diagnostic procedures, monitoring for patients undergoing treatment, PML management, and other topics of interest including the management of patients discontinuing natalizumab. MATERIAL AND METHODS: This updated version followed the method used in the first consensus. A group of Spanish experts in multiple sclerosis (the authors of the present document) reviewed all currently available literature on natalizumab and identified the relevant topics would need updating based on their clinical experience. The initial draft passed through review cycles until the final version was completed. RESULTS AND CONCLUSIONS: Studies in clinical practice have demonstrated that changing to natalizumab is more effective than switching between immunomodulators. They favour early treatment with natalizumab rather than using natalizumab in a later stage as a rescue therapy. Although the drug is very effective, its potential adverse effects need to be considered, with particular attention to the patient's likelihood of developing PML. The neurologist should carefully explain the risks and benefits of the treatment, comparing them to the risks of multiple sclerosis in terms the patient can understand. Before treatment is started, laboratory tests and magnetic resonance images should be available to permit proper follow-up. The risk of PML should be stratified as high, medium, or low according to presence or absence of anti-JC virus antibodies, history of immunosuppressive therapy, and treatment duration. Although the presence of anti-JC virus antibodies is a significant finding, it should not be considered an absolute contraindication for natalizumab. This update provides general recommendations, but neurologists must use their clinical expertise to provide personalised follow-up for each patient.
